.elementor-880 .elementor-element.elementor-element-5d51d3c9{--display:flex;--flex-direction:column;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--align-items:center;--overflow:hidden;--padding-top:50px;--padding-bottom:100px;--padding-left:20px;--padding-right:20px;}.elementor-880 .elementor-element.elementor-element-25b817f1{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 50px) 0px;}.elementor-880 .elementor-element.elementor-element-14150f2d{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 50px) 0px;}.elementor-widget-button .elementor-button{background-color:var( --e-global-color-accent );font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button{background-color:var( --e-global-color-4f44bab );font-family:"Inter", Sans-serif;font-size:16px;font-weight:700;text-transform:uppercase;fill:#1D5150;color:#1D5150;border-style:solid;border-width:1px 1px 1px 1px;border-color:var( --e-global-color-primary );border-radius:100px 100px 100px 100px;}.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button:hover, .el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button:focus{background-color:var( --e-global-color-primary );color:#FFFFFF;}.elementor-880 .elementor-element.elementor-element-581b0197{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;}.elementor-880 .elementor-element.elementor-element-581b0197.elementor-element{--align-self:center;}.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button-content-wrapper{flex-direction:row-reverse;}.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button .elementor-button-content-wrapper{gap:15px;}.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button:hover svg, .el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button:focus svg{fill:#FFFFFF;}.elementor-widget-image .widget-image-caption{color:var( --e-global-color-text );font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);}.elementor-880 .elementor-element.elementor-element-100d3faa{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;top:13px;z-index:-1;}body:not(.rtl) .elementor-880 .elementor-element.elementor-element-100d3faa{left:0px;}body.rtl .elementor-880 .elementor-element.elementor-element-100d3faa{right:0px;}.elementor-880 .elementor-element.elementor-element-100d3faa img{width:1000px;max-width:1000px;opacity:0.23;}@media(max-width:1024px){.elementor-880 .elementor-element.elementor-element-5d51d3c9{--padding-top:0px;--padding-bottom:100px;--padding-left:20px;--padding-right:20px;}}@media(max-width:767px){.elementor-880 .elementor-element.elementor-element-5d51d3c9{--padding-top:0px;--padding-bottom:50px;--padding-left:20px;--padding-right:20px;}.elementor-880 .elementor-element.elementor-element-25b817f1{padding:0px 0px 0px 0px;}.elementor-880 .elementor-element.elementor-element-14150f2d{marg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;padding:0px 0px 0px 0px;}.elementor-880 .elementor-element.elementor-element-581b0197{width:100%;max-width:100%;margin:20px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;}.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button{font-size:13px;}.elementor-880 .elementor-element.elementor-element-100d3faa{top:116px;}}/* Start custom CSS for button, class: .elementor-element-581b0197 */.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button-icon i,
.elementor-880 .elementor-element.elementor-element-581b0197 .elementor-button-icon svg {
  color: #1D5150 !important;
  fill: #1D5150 !important;
  transition: transform 0.3s ease;
}

.elementor-880 .elementor-element.elementor-element-581b0197:hover .elementor-button-icon i,
.elementor-880 .elementor-element.elementor-element-581b0197:hover .elementor-button-icon svg {
  transform: rotate(45deg);
  color: #ffff !important;
  fill: #ffff !important;
}/* End custom CSS */